Seven years ago I started a handwriting project with my kids.


We did "Letter of the Day" summers in 2006, 2008, and 2010.

And even though they've grown a lot, we're doing it again.


Our letter days are not in alphabetical order. The method we use is from Handwriting Without Tears by Jan Olsen. While our calendar does follow the book exactly, I do try to stick with the author's logical sequence of letters based on how the lower-case letter is formed. For example, first comes "magic C", then O; V is before W, etc.


My first-grader will use Olsen's My Printing Book and Printing Power. (I've set up the product pictures this year so that clicking on the image will take you directly to amazon.com)

My third-grader will be working on his cursive using Writing with Prayer by Michael J. McHugh.


My middle school boys think they are too old for this, but handwriting is essential. I will be working through Fix It Write by Nan Jay Barchowsky along with them.
 


We don't work on a Letter of the Day every day, so please have patience as you follow along. All 26 letter days will happen before school starts!
